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of oil extraction equipment technology, specifically to an oil extraction drill pipe fixing device. Background Technology

[0002] With the rapid development of people's lives, oil extraction has become increasingly important. Drill pipes are indispensable in the oil extraction process, as they are used to drill into the ground with drill bits, making it easier for workers to extract underground oil.

[0003] However, during the use of the equipment, when the pressure inside the oil well suddenly becomes too high or a blowout occurs, the manual slips are subjected to a large upward impact force. Because the manual slips themselves have weak resistance to impact and weak blowout prevention capabilities, the high-pressure fluid flowing inside the well will quickly push the manual slips out of the wellhead, leaving people with very little time to react. In response to the above problems, the following solutions are proposed. Summary of the Invention

[0028] The present invention has the following beneficial effects:

[0029] (1) During the placement of the slips, the slider is subjected to the squeezing force from the support base. The slips slide relative to the support base. After sliding along the inclined plane, the horizontal straight distance between the bottom of the slider and the limiting block becomes shorter. The limiting block can just hold the bottom of the slider. After placement, the limiting rod is pushed to slide into the limiting groove, so that the limiting can be performed at the same time as the slips are installed. When the slips are removed after use, the operation can be reversed. This avoids the slips being subjected to a large upward impact force when the pressure in the well is too high or when the well blows out, which will quickly push the slips out of the wellhead. The response time is shorter, which improves the slips' ability to prevent blowout and extends the response time.

[0030] (2) When the slip device is placed, the slip will retract. When the slip is fully retracted, the two hooks will squeeze each other. Under the action of mutual squeezing force, the hooks will rotate around the limiting shaft. During rotation, the limiting block will slide relative to the hook. When it slides to a certain extent, it will fall down and lock the hook, thus achieving self-locking. This avoids the connection between the slips from loosening under the action of impact force, and the slips may also have an upward sliding tendency, which would lead to insufficient clamping force between the slips and the drill rod, resulting in reduced static friction between the two and inability to effectively clamp the drill rod, causing it to slide.

[0031] (3) When mud, gravel, and other materials impact upwards in the well, the clamping teeth and drill pipe are in a clamped state. The teeth are close to the drill pipe sidewall, which initially prevents mud penetration and gravel impact on the teeth located inside, causing the teeth to wear too quickly. The mud and gravel will be discharged outwards along the guide channel to release the pressure of the high-pressure liquid in the well, so that the pressure can be released. The anti-leakage groove will further hinder the decompression of water and mud seeping in from the gap, reduce the penetration capacity of water and mud, avoid the impact of gravel and mud on the teeth, which greatly reduces the service life of the teeth, and to a certain extent, release the impact force of the high-pressure liquid.

[0032] (4) After long-term use, the teeth of the device of the present invention will be severely worn due to various reasons and cannot be used. At this time, the tooth can be pulled out from the mounting slot and then a new tooth can be installed into the mounting slot to complete the replacement of the tooth. Attached Figure Description

[0065] Example 2, please refer to Figure 3 - Figure 11 The present invention is an oil drilling pipe fixing device. Based on the first embodiment, the support assembly 11 includes a drill pipe 113 disposed on the side wall of the slip 121, and the side wall of the drill pipe 113 is slidably connected to the side wall of the tooth 312.

[0066] The limiting component 21 includes a slider 212 that is slidably connected to the side wall of the first slide groove 211. The side wall of the slider 212 is provided with a second slide groove 213, and a limiting rod 214 is slidably connected to the side wall of the second slide groove 213.

[0067] First, the slips are placed inside the well using a slips pick-and-place device. During the placement process, slider 212, under its own weight, initially positions itself at the bottom of groove 211. Slider 212 moves downwards along with slip 121, and its bottom just moves below limit block 112 before contacting support base 111. When slider 212 begins to contact support base 111, it experiences a compressive force from the support base 111, causing slip 121 to slide relative to support base 111. 12 will slide upward along the inner wall of the slide groove 211. After sliding along the inclined plane, the horizontal straight distance between the bottom of the slider 212 and the limiting block 112 will become shorter. The limiting block 112 can just hold the bottom of the slider 212. After placement, push the limiting rod 214 to slide into the limiting groove 215, so that the slip is automatically limited after installation. When it is removed after use, the operation can be reversed. This avoids the slip being subjected to a large upward impact force when the pressure in the well is too high or when there is a blowout, which will quickly push the slip out of the wellhead. The response time is shorter, which improves the slip's blowout prevention capability and extends the response time.

[0068] The self-locking assembly 22 also includes a limiting block 3 224 rotatably connected to the inner wall of the housing 221. The end of the limiting block 3 224 away from the hook 223 extends to the outside of the housing 221, and the side wall of the limiting block 3 224 is slidably connected to the side wall of the hook 223. When the well pressure is high or a blowout occurs, the drill pipe 113 and the slips are subjected to a large upward impact, requiring greater friction to restrict the movement of the drill pipe. As the slip device is placed, the slips 121 will retract, the distance between the slips 121 will gradually shorten, and the friction between them and the drill pipe 113 will gradually increase. When the slips are fully retracted, the two hooks 223 will squeeze against each other. Under the action of mutual squeezing force, the hooks 223 will rotate around the limiting shaft 222. During rotation, the limiting block 224 will slide relative to the hooks 223. When the sliding reaches a certain extent, it will fall downward and lock the hooks 223, achieving self-locking. This avoids the connection between the slips 121 from loosening under the impact force, and also prevents the slips from having an upward sliding tendency, which would lead to insufficient clamping force between the slips and the drill pipe, reducing the static friction between them, and making it impossible to effectively clamp the drill pipe and cause it to slide.

[0069] The leak-proof component 31 includes a leak-proof groove 313 provided on the side wall of the tooth 312, and a flow guide groove 314 is provided on the side wall of the tooth 312.

[0070] The leak-proof component 31 also includes several guide plates 315 fixedly connected to the inner wall of the guide channel 314, and the guide plates 315 are all made of high-strength metal.

[0071] When mud, gravel, and other materials impact upwards in the well, the clamping teeth 312 and drill pipe 113 are tightly fitted together. The teeth adhere closely to the sidewall of drill pipe 113, initially preventing mud penetration and excessive wear of the teeth caused by gravel impacting the inner teeth. Mud and gravel are discharged outwards along the guide groove 314, relieving pressure on both sides and concentrating pressure in the middle of the clamping teeth 312. The anti-leakage groove 313 further impedes the pressure reduction of water and mud seeping in from the gaps, reducing the penetration capacity of water and mud and preventing gravel and mud from impacting the teeth, which would significantly reduce the service life of the teeth.

[0072] After prolonged use, the teeth of the device may become severely worn due to various reasons and become unusable. In this case, simply pull the retaining tooth 312 out of the mounting slot 311 and then install a new retaining tooth 312 into the mounting slot 311 to complete the replacement of the retaining tooth.
